Python是一种面向对象和解释型的计算机程序语言。在许多领域,如科学、数据分析和Web开发,Python已成为广泛使用的语言之一。Python的使用界面是一个重要的组成部分,因为它提供了用户控制和操作程序的方式。
Python的使用界面通常由三个主要组成部分组成:
- 命令行界面(Command Line Interface, CLI)
- 集成开发环境(Integrated Development Environment, IDE)
- 代码编辑器(Code Editor)
命令行界面
命令行界面是一个用户可以在其中键入命令来与Python交互的命令提示符窗口。这是学习Python的好方法,因为它可以让用户在交互模式下查看结果。在Windows系统中,用户可以使用Python自带的IDLE来使用命令行界面。
PS C:\>python Python 3.8.3 (tags/v3.8.3:6f8c832, May 13 2020, 22:37:02) [MSC v.1925 64 bit (AMD64)] on win32 Type "help", "copyright", "credits" or "license" for more information. >>> 2 + 2 4 >>> print("Hello World") Hello World
集成开发环境
IDE是一个把编辑器、调试器、编译器等功能综合到一起的软件。IDE为用户提供了一个集成的开发环境,可以方便地编写Python程序,调试代码以及管理项目。常用的Python IDE有PyCharm、Visual Studio Code等。
from random import randint def generate_random_number(): start_num = 1 end_num = 100 rand_num = randint(start_num, end_num) return rand_num if __name__ == '__main__': print("Random number is ", generate_random_number())
代码编辑器
代码编辑器通常是更加简单的一种工具,只专注于提供一个窗口来输入、编辑和保存代码。用户还可以对代码进行格式化、突出显示和代码片段等操作,以提高代码的可读性。常用的Python代码编辑器有Sublime Text、Notepad++等。
# This program prints Hello, world! print('Hello, world!')
总之,Python的使用界面提供了许多选择,以适应不同的需求和技能水平。无论是使用命令行界面、集成开发环境还是代码编辑器,都可以帮助用户更轻松地使用Python进行编程。